A Closer Look at the Recent Surge
Bitcoin Japan Corporation’s recent rise in stock price to ¥355.00 marks a significant 13.05% increase in a single day, backed by a volume of 34,176,300 shares—four times its average. This push highlights investor optimism, potentially fueled by upcoming strategic announcements or favorable macroeconomic conditions in Japan.
Financial Health and Metrics
Despite the recent surge, Bitcoin Japan Corporation presents a mixed financial tableau. It operates with a market cap of ¥19.97 billion but struggles with a negative EPS of -¥8.59 and a PE ratio of -41.33. The company has shown a weak revenue growth rate of -16.11% and net income decline of 21.97% annually, reflecting operational challenges.
Technical Indicators and Momentum Analysis
Technical analysis shows Bitcoin Japan’s RSI at 39.21, indicating neither an overbought nor oversold market. The MACD sits at -71.16, showing bearish momentum despite the recent price increase. Volatility remains high, with an ATR of 89.44, suggesting that investors may experience continued swings in stock value.
